For anchorages in non-cracked concrete such as base plates, supports and wall brackets and for mounting joint tapes. Anchoring in masonry: Canopies, door and window frames, facade substructures, battens, gates etc.
The universal injection system for non-cracked concrete, damp concrete, water-filled boreholes and masonry made from solid or perforated brick. The VM-EA injection system is an injection system for fixtures in non-cracked concrete and masonry. The system includes an epoxy acrylate-based, styrene-free chemical injection mortar in a mortar cartridge, as well as a VMU-A anchor rod, V-A or commercially available threaded rod with acceptance test certificate 3.1 (e.g. VM-A), as well as a nut and washer. When used in perforated brick, a perforated sleeve is also required.
Advantages
- Versatile injection system for different applications in concrete and masonry
- Approved for non-cracked concrete
- Approved for installation in damp concrete and in water-filled drill holes
- Approved for aerated concrete and solid and perforated brick masonry; dry or wet
- Approved with anchor rods and for commercially available threaded rods with proven strength (acceptance test certificate 3.1)
- Approved with adjustable push-through perforated sleeve VM-SH 16 x 130/330 for bridging insulation systems and other soft
- surfaces
- Substrate temperature during application: -5°C to +40°C
- Ambient temperature after full curing: -40°C to +80°C
- Variable anchoring depths for added flexibility
Advice
- Tubular film cartridge, suitable for silicone guns.
- Perforated sleeve VM-SH 16 x 130/330 enables fixtures in perforated brick through insulation boards.
